Kodak Black has cleaned itself!

So what’s up with all the sober and clear comments? Well, last week, the ‘Super Gremlin’ rapper opened up about cutting back on his drug use and how he feels about making that lifestyle change.

In a video shared on social networks, Kodak revealed that he had “never been this happy in my life”. While he made it clear that he’s not against Perc (short for the painkiller Percocet), he said he hasn’t taken a single pill since his last stint behind bars. That’s down from the 40 Percs average he was said to have been involved with.

“I can’t believe it myself,” he shared.
